Output adc8c921aa1c730b2d29a2633dbd06e50ec97713158dae1f1477695655f5175f:30

value
147720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52cc39f267a74864900aa6ac3cf0ccd58d80eb21 OP_EQUAL
address
39EozAoLTrEp7qkbWj4HZasDzTNf3ptoXV
transaction
adc8c921aa1c730b2d29a2633dbd06e50ec97713158dae1f1477695655f5175f
confirmations
137904
spent
true